To: Executive Team
Subject: Vessa One launch plan

Board summary. Launch date locked for 14 May. Pilot markets: Calder Bay and Norwick. Inventory commitments signed; marketing spend capped at the Q2 figure approved last month. Press embargo holds until launch minus three days. Risks: component supply (medium), competitor response (low). Go/no-go review is 30 April. Full deck follows Friday. The confidential strategic framing for the board sits below.

internal memo for kawip-hadug: Headcount on the Wenwyn team goes from 7 to 140 by the end of January. Gross margin on Wenwyn came in at 20 percent against a plan of 15 percent.

**Q: I'm extracting the user module from the Burrowstone monolith — how do I get access to the legacy schema?**

A: The user module split is tracked under the Fernlatch project. New contractors get read access to the extracted service repos automatically, but the legacy user tables live behind a sealed credentials bundle because they contain production fixtures. To unseal the bundle on your first setup run, use the recovery passphrase provided below.

recovery phrase for fajeg-hagug: holox-fenmir

Handover note — Crumbwheel order cutoffs.

Welcome aboard. The bakery cutoff rule in Crumbwheel closes same-day orders at 14:00 local to each storefront, not UTC — this has bitten us twice. Holiday overrides live in the calendar service and take precedence silently, so always check there first when a cutoff looks wrong. To unlock the calendar service's admin console after a restart, enter the recovery passphrase below.

vault phrase of bagap-bahaf = silion-pelox-sorox-casdor-quenwyn-fraax-eliox-praael-kelion-quenvan-kasox-rusael-norius-belvan